#1

Harmony Health Care Institute

Merrimack, New Hampshire
77 Total Awards
$11,904 Avg Student Debt

Our analysis found Harmony Health Care Institute to be the most popular school for nursing students who want to pursue a undergraduate certificate in New Hampshire. This very small private for-profit school is located in Merrimack, New Hampshire, and it awarded 77 undergraduate certificates in 2021-2022.

By the time they get their undergraduate certificate, students from this school have racked up an average of $11,904 in student loans. Of those students who received their degree, 91% were women.

#2

River Valley Community College

Claremont, New Hampshire
55 Total Awards
$6,940 Average Tuition & Fees
$12,568 Avg Student Debt

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end River Valley Community College. It ranked #2 on our 2023 Most Popular Nursing Undergraduate Certificate Schools in New Hampshire list. River Valley Community College is a very small public school located in Claremont, New Hampshire that handed out 55 undergraduate certificates in 2021-2022.

Students from New Hampshire who attend NH Community Technical College - Claremont full time pay an average of $6,940 in tuition and fees. If you are from out of state, expect to pay an average of $15,190. Undergraduate Certificate recipients from NH Community Technical College - Claremont accumulate an average of $12,568 in student debt by the time they complete their degree. Around 87% of those degree recipients were women.

Depending on your major, you may be able to take online classes at NH Community Technical College - Claremont. In fact, around 80% of the undergraduate population registered for at least one online class in 2020-2021.
